Mallet Auction Special Sale that features autographed books and handwritten manuscripts will be held on 20th March

In this auction 98 lots will be offered, all of the items are valuable and hard to reach in the market. The lots including Murakami's novels, translations, and essays signed by him, 35 records actually played at the jazz bar 'Peter Cat’ he ran before his debut; illustrations and prints for book designs, related journals, and 22 lots of highly rare handwritten manuscripts of translations and essays.
All these items have been collected over the years by Mr. Shun Kurokochi known for his private collection of Yoshitomo Nara.
There are about 50 lots of signed books, including 'Hear the Wind Sing' and 'Pinball, 1973' from his early trilogy, 'Hard-Boiled Wonderland and the End of the World' with preface and autograph, also his popular essay 'Murakami Radio', and 'A Slow Boat to China'. The handwritten manuscripts include two drafts of translations for Raymond Carver whom Murakami first introduced to Japan, two drafts of translations for Paul Theroux's works, 13 drafts of the essay 'A Wild Cinema Chase', and two drafts of essays from the 1980s magazine 'DOLIVE'.
Other items include columns, essays, a number of magazines of the time with feature articles on the artist, original drawings by Mizumaru Anzai, and prints by Ayumi Ohashi.

Mallet Japan auction report Sale no. 200618
Mallet Japan successfully held its second auction of the year 'Modern and Contemporary Art Sale' on June 18 2020.
Due to the declaration of the state of emergency concerning COVID-19 by Japanese government, the auction which was previously scheduled in May has been postponed to June. This sale has been awaited by the customers for more than 4 months. To ensure safety for all customers and our staffs, Mallet has taken countermeasures to prevent the infection of the virus. All of the bidders and staffs in the saleroom were wearing masks, the telephone bid sections has been isolated by panels, also this time most of the bidders were tend to attend by telephone and online real-time bidding via Invaluable.com, or using absentee bids.
As expected, the highest bids are created for the woks by established artists, while there are many good results made by a wide range of artists from well-knowns to whom rarely appear in our market.
Yayoi Kusama is one of the most premier contemporary Japanese artists in the world. Her woodcut print 'All about Mt. Fuji that I have loved my whole life' reached the best result in this sale. Specialists from Mallet says the price of prints by Kusama should remain stable in the future.
Some highlights in this sale:
LOT 77 Yayoi Kusama
woodcut in colours ‘All about Mt. Fuji that I have loved my whole life’
Estimate: 2,500,000-3,500,000 JPY, hammer price: 4,200,000 JPY
LOT 120 KYNE
screenprint in colours ‘Untitled’
Estimate: 300,000-500,000 JPY, hammer price: 1,100,000 JPY
LOT 163 Osamu Suzuki
pale blue glazed porcelain ‘The horse’
Estimate: 500,000-700,000 JPY, hammer price: 3,100,000 JPY

Change to Mallet Auction Commission Fee
Please note that from July 2017 the commission fee for Mallet Auction will change.
New Commission Fee
16.2% of the hammer price will be added on to the final hammer price on a per-lot basis.
Example) If the hammer price is 1,500,000 JPY
Hammer Price: 1,500,000 JPY+Commission Fee: 243,000 JPY = Total Purchase Price: 1,743,000 JPY
Previous Commission Fees
When the hammer price was up to and including 1 million JPY, 16.2% of the hammer price was added on to the final hammer price on a per-lot basis
When the hammer price was over 1 million JPY, 16.2% of 1 million JPY plus 10.8% of the amount above 1 million JPY was added on to the final hammer price on a per-lot basis
Example) If the hammer price was 1,500,000 JPY
Hammer Price: 1,500,000 JPY+Commission Fees: 216,000 JPY = Total Purchase Price: 1,716,000 JPY
(Please note that no Japanese taxes will be imposed on purchases made by overseas customers)
